Etr/ 2/ W/ Wayirrutu wayirrutu Egl/ Etr/ W/ Langalarra langalarra Egl/ cut ear cut ear Etr/ 3/ W/ Nyarlajanparla lurnujurnuju wuyamiyarnpa Egl/ Etr/ Extra information recorded This used to be a whole big ceremony but now there are only two songs. Paddy suddenly remembered another one half way through the recording. Thomas seemed to know these well too when he remembered them. The place for these songs is around Napperby. In the ceremony men dance at the eastern side of the ground. A group of men who are singing sit to their western side facing towards the east and a group of women who also sing at various points sit behind them facing towards the east as well. Paddy explained that there were different purlapa from each camp around Yuendumu. This one is his. There has not been an opportunity to hold purlapa since the 1950s and 1960s except for different contexts such as the ‘Country visits’ that the school have for the kids..
